1942 Dodge D22 Custom: 230-Cubic-Inch Flathead Six
Dodge built the D22 for the 1942 model year around a 230.2-cubic-inch L-head inline-six rated at 105 horsepower. Civilian automobile production ended in early 1942 as American factories converted to military work, leaving the D22 with an unusually short production run and a mixture of conventional bright trim and federally mandated conservation finishes.
The Custom was the better-appointed branch of the D22 passenger-car family, paired with Dodge's full-size 119.5-inch-wheelbase chassis and offered in several closed and open body configurations. Its waterfall-like grille, broad fenders, concealed running boards, and hood extending into the front bodywork gave it a distinctly new appearance compared with the 1941 Dodge.
Best known for its association with the final months of American civilian car production before wartime conversion, the D22 Custom is especially compelling when its original blackout trim, flathead-six drivetrain, Fluid Drive equipment, and factory documentation remain intact.

The model-year designation matters because production began during 1941, as was normal Detroit practice, but the car was sold as a 1942 Dodge. Surviving registrations can therefore show dates that do not neatly correspond with the model year, making serial, engine, body, and title evidence more useful than registration year alone.
Why the D22 Custom Matters
The D22 records the point at which ordinary American automobile production met wartime material controls. Nickel, chromium, aluminum, rubber, and other strategic materials became increasingly restricted, and cars assembled late in the civilian run could receive painted or otherwise simplified exterior fittings in place of normal brightwork. Collectors generally refer to these as blackout cars, although the exact treatment must be evaluated against build timing and surviving factory evidence rather than appearance alone.
This was not merely a 1941 Dodge with a changed model number. The 1942 body adopted a lower-looking front treatment, horizontal grille elements, headlights integrated into the fenders, and broader sheet metal that made the car appear heavier and more formal. The Custom's additional interior and exterior appointments placed it above the Deluxe, while the underlying side-valve six and conservative chassis reflected Dodge's emphasis on durability and low-speed flexibility.
Historical Context and Development
Dodge entered the 1942 model year as Chrysler Corporation's medium-priced marque, above Plymouth and below DeSoto and Chrysler. Chevrolet's Special Deluxe, Ford's Super Deluxe, Pontiac, Oldsmobile, and comparable Buick models formed the competitive field, but the selling season was overtaken by the United States' entry into the Second World War.
Engineering priorities remained practical. Dodge retained an L-head six, hydraulic brakes, independent front suspension, and a separate frame rather than adopting an unproven powertrain or structural concept for a model year already constrained by material policy. Fluid Drive was central to Dodge advertising because it reduced driveline shock and allowed the car to remain stopped in gear with the clutch engaged, although it did not eliminate the conventional gearbox or clutch pedal.
Federal restrictions progressively changed what manufacturers could install, and civilian passenger-car assembly ceased early in 1942. Exact D22 totals are not consistently presented across surviving references because figures may combine trims, body styles, calendar-year assembly, and model-year production. Any claimed production number should therefore be checked against the scope and terminology of its source.
Exterior and Interior Design
The D22's nose is its strongest visual identifier. Horizontal grille bars span a broad central opening, while the hood and front fenders form a smoother composition than the more upright 1941 design. The roof remains tall by later standards, and the generous glass area, rounded rear quarters, and long passenger compartment reveal the packaging priorities of an American family car built before low rooflines became fashionable.
Custom interiors generally used upgraded upholstery and trim relative to the Deluxe, with a broad painted-metal dashboard, centrally grouped instruments, a large steering wheel, and column-mounted gear selection. Restorers should resist applying generic postwar fabrics, highly polished woodgrain, or excessive chrome. Correct materials and finishes depended on body style, production date, and the restrictions in force when the car was assembled.
Engine and Drivetrain
The D22's six-cylinder engine used a cast-iron block and detachable cast-iron cylinder head, with its valves arranged beside the cylinders. The long 4.625-inch stroke helped produce useful torque at modest engine speed, while the low compression ratio suited the fuel quality and operating conditions of the period. A single downdraft carburetor and mechanical fuel pump supplied the engine.
Ignition was by a distributor, coil, and spark plugs operating from a six-volt electrical system. Pressure lubrication served the principal engine bearings, and the cooling system used a belt-driven water pump, fan, radiator, and thermostat. Carburetor, distributor, generator, and starter markings deserve careful examination because decades of service often left otherwise authentic cars with interchange parts from other Chrysler products.
The following specifications describe the standard D22 engine architecture. Carburetor manufacturer and certain detail fittings can differ according to production supply and later service replacement.
| Specification | D22 Custom |
|---|---|
| Engine configuration | L-head inline-six |
| Displacement | 230.2 cu in |
| Bore | 3.25 in |
| Stroke | 4.625 in |
| Compression ratio | 6.7:1 |
| Factory-rated output | 105 hp at 3,600 rpm |
| Induction | Naturally aspirated, single downdraft carburetor |
| Fuel delivery | Engine-driven mechanical pump |
| Transmission | Three-speed manual with column shift |
| Final drive | Hypoid rear axle |
A Fluid Drive car places a sealed fluid coupling ahead of the dry clutch and three-speed transmission. The driver can still shift conventionally, but the coupling cushions engagement and permits the vehicle to idle while stationary in gear. Fluid Drive should not be confused with Chrysler's later semi-automatic transmissions.
Chassis, Suspension, and Braking
The D22 used a steel body mounted on a separate frame. Independent front suspension with coil springs improved wheel control over the beam axles still associated with older designs, while the live rear axle rode on longitudinal semi-elliptic leaf springs. This arrangement favored durability, load capacity, and predictable behavior on uneven roads.
Dodge continued with four-wheel hydraulic drum brakes. Recirculating-ball steering, a large-diameter steering wheel, and relatively narrow cross-ply tires provided leverage at parking speed, although no one should mistake the system for modern power-assisted steering.
These chassis dimensions and components are useful when checking whether a restoration retains the correct stance and period wheel equipment.
| Component | Specification |
|---|---|
| Construction | Steel body on separate frame |
| Wheelbase | 119.5 in |
| Front suspension | Independent, coil springs |
| Rear suspension | Live axle, semi-elliptic leaf springs |
| Steering | Manual recirculating-ball type |
| Brakes | Four-wheel hydraulic drums |
| Standard wheel format | 16-inch steel wheels |
Ride height is particularly revealing on restored cars. Radial tires of an unsuitable profile, tired rear springs, incorrect front coils, or oversized modern wheels can alter the body-to-wheel relationship and make a structurally sound D22 sit incorrectly.
Driving Experience and Handling Dynamics
The flathead six delivers its best work at low and moderate engine speeds. Throttle response is measured rather than sharp, but the long stroke and modest gearing allow the Dodge to pull away without constant revving. A properly rebuilt engine should feel smooth, quiet, and willing, not harsh or chronically overheated.
Manual steering is heavy while parking and becomes calmer once the car is moving. The independent front end filters broken pavement effectively for the period, while the leaf-sprung rear axle can feel busier over closely spaced bumps. Body roll arrives early by modern standards, but sound dampers, correct springs, and properly inflated cross-ply tires produce progressive behavior rather than uncontrolled wallow.
The three-speed column shift rewards deliberate movements and a fully adjusted clutch linkage. Fluid Drive softens take-up and driveline snatch, but it also makes the car feel less mechanically direct. The hydraulic drums can provide adequate stopping power when correctly arced, adjusted, and free of contaminated linings, though repeated high-speed braking quickly reveals the limitations of period drum construction.
Identification and Originality
A D22 should be identified through the serial-number plate, the engine-number stamping, body tags where present, and original paperwork. It does not have a modern 17-character VIN. Plate location and format should be compared with authenticated Dodge material for the assembly plant involved, especially when a title appears to use an engine number rather than the vehicle serial number.
The engine number is normally stamped on a machined boss near the upper front area of the block, and an original-type D22 engine should carry the appropriate model prefix. A prefix alone does not prove that the engine was installed in that body when new. Chrysler Corporation did not use the later collector concept of a VIN stamped throughout every major component, so matching numbers should mean documented original components, not merely castings of the correct general type.
Engine casting dates, generator and starter tags, distributor numbers, wheel dates, glass markings, and body hardware can support a production timeline. They must be interpreted together because normal warranty and maintenance work could introduce period service parts very early in a car's life.
Blackout Trim and Production-Date Evidence
A true blackout D22 should not be created simply by painting the chrome on an earlier car. Late civilian-production examples may exhibit restricted brightwork and painted trim, but implementation could differ as inventories were consumed and regulations changed. Surviving photographs, factory sales material, Chrysler Historical Services documentation where available, and evidence beneath untouched finishes offer a stronger case than an owner's recollection.
Custom scripts, grille components, hood ornaments, hubcaps, interior handles, upholstery, and dashboard finishes are frequently lost or replaced with Deluxe, 1941, or postwar pieces. Reproduction rubber and service items are available from specialist suppliers, but model-specific decorative metal, correct lenses, body hardware, and original interior materials can be substantially harder to locate.
Paint colors should be selected from Dodge or Chrysler Corporation literature applicable to the production period, then confirmed against protected original paint where possible. Modern interpretations based solely on a color name can miss the original metallic content, tone, or gloss.
Variant and Trim Breakdown
The D22 family was divided principally between Deluxe and Custom equipment levels. The blackout designation describes a production treatment caused by material restrictions, not a separate factory performance or homologation model.
| Variant / Code | Year | Engine / Output | Market | Key Difference |
|---|---|---|---|---|
| D22 Deluxe | 1942 | 230.2 cu in L-head six, 105 hp | United States | Lower-priced trim with simpler interior and exterior appointments |
| D22 Custom | 1942 | 230.2 cu in L-head six, 105 hp | United States | Upgraded upholstery, trim, and equipment relative to the Deluxe |
| D22 blackout-production cars | Late civilian production, 1942 | 230.2 cu in L-head six, 105 hp | United States | Reduced or painted brightwork under wartime material restrictions; not a separate formal trim series |
Body style and trim must be considered together. A genuine Custom is not established by adding scripts or brightwork to a Deluxe body, and late-production conservation parts should not automatically be interpreted as missing trim.
Performance and Dimensional Specifications
Standardized acceleration and top-speed figures are not consistently documented for the D22 Custom, and body weight, axle ratio, tire size, engine condition, and Fluid Drive equipment all affect performance. The dimensions below are more dependable restoration references than unsourced modern estimates.
| Measurement | Factory Specification |
|---|---|
| Wheelbase | 119.5 in |
| Overall length | Approximately 206.8 in |
| Overall width | Approximately 74.8 in |
| Engine output | 105 hp at 3,600 rpm |
| Nominal wheel diameter | 16 in |
Published weight figures differ by body style and equipment, so a single curb-weight number would misrepresent the family. Convertible, sedan, coupe, and station-wagon bodies cannot be compared meaningfully without using body-specific factory data.
Compared With Related Dodge Models
1941 Dodge D19 and D20
The preceding 1941 Dodge models share the company's flathead-six philosophy and Fluid Drive marketing, but their frontal sheet metal, grille treatment, and model identification differ from the D22. Mechanical interchange can tempt restorers to fit earlier components, particularly when original 1942 decorative parts are unavailable.
1946 to 1948 Dodge D24
The postwar D24 retained strongly prewar engineering and styling themes, but it is not a continuation of the D22 model code. D24 cars are more numerous, and their mechanical components can become donors for D22 restorations. Visible postwar substitutions, however, reduce the historical integrity of a scarce 1942 car.
Plymouth, DeSoto, and Chrysler Contemporaries
Chrysler Corporation shared engineering practices and many supplier relationships across its marques, but differences in wheelbase, engine dimensions, trim, and model-specific hardware prevent careless interchange. A component that physically bolts on may still have the wrong casting number, control arrangement, finish, or date for a D22 Custom.
Ownership and Restoration Notes
The 230.2-cubic-inch flathead six is fundamentally durable when its cooling passages, oiling system, valve seats, and bearing clearances are correct. Long-stored engines often conceal corrosion around the water-distribution tube, sediment in the block, stuck valves, hardened seals, and fuel-system contamination. Repeated overheating should not be dismissed as normal flathead behavior.
Fluid Drive couplings are robust but require the correct fluid, sound seals, proper clutch adjustment, and accurate diagnosis. Oil leaking from the rear main area, transmission input, or fluid coupling can contaminate the clutch. A conventional clutch repair becomes considerably more involved if the coupling, bellhousing, or related linkages also need work.
Rust inspection should concentrate on floors, rocker structures, lower doors, trunk edges, rear body mounts, fender attachment points, spare-wheel wells, and the frame around suspension and body mounts. Closed bodies can look presentable while moisture-damaged timber, insulation, or floor structure remains hidden. Wood-bodied station wagons require specialist assessment far beyond ordinary steel-body restoration.
Routine maintenance includes frequent chassis lubrication, brake adjustment, ignition-point inspection, cooling-system care, and attention to axle and transmission lubricants. Owners who treat the D22 like a modern sealed-for-life vehicle create many of the drivability faults later blamed on old design.
Buyer and Inspection Points
A worthwhile inspection should establish identity and completeness before concentrating on paint quality. D22-specific trim and documented wartime features can cost more time to replace than rebuilding the conventional drivetrain.
| Area | What to Check | Why It Matters |
|---|---|---|
| Identity | Compare serial plate, title, engine stamping, body tags, and historical paperwork | Older titles may use an engine number, and undocumented substitutions complicate registration and authenticity |
| Blackout equipment | Look for period finish evidence beneath trim, behind fasteners, and in dated photographs | Freshly painted chrome does not establish a genuine late-production blackout car |
| Cooling system | Inspect radiator flow, water-distribution tube, block sediment, pump, and temperature behavior | Internal corrosion and blocked coolant flow can cause persistent overheating |
| Engine | Check cold oil pressure, compression balance, valve noise, exhaust smoke, and block cracks | A running flathead can still require extensive machine work |
| Fluid Drive and clutch | Check leakage, clutch release, coupling behavior, and shift quality when warm | Misadjustment and oil contamination can imitate major transmission faults |
| Brakes | Inspect cylinders, hoses, drums, linings, adjustment, and evidence of fluid contamination | Correctly functioning hydraulic drums require sound parts and accurate adjustment |
| Body and frame | Examine floors, rockers, mounts, lower panels, trunk, frame rails, and suspension pickups | Cosmetic repairs can conceal structural corrosion and poor body alignment |
| Trim and interior | Inventory grille bars, scripts, lamps, handles, hubcaps, instruments, and original seat hardware | D22-specific decorative components are harder to source than routine mechanical parts |
| Electrical system | Verify cable gauge, grounding, charging output, wiring condition, and six-volt components | Thin 12-volt-style battery cables often cause poor cranking on a sound six-volt system |
A complete, unrestored car with worn paint can be a better restoration basis than a freshly refinished example assembled from several model years. Photographs taken before disassembly, labeled hardware, upholstery samples, and records of original finishes have unusual value on a car whose production details changed during a compressed and unsettled model year.
Collector and Market Relevance
Collectors value the D22 Custom for historical context, completeness, and production-date evidence rather than competition pedigree. Dodge did not create it as a racing or homologation model, and inflated performance claims do the car no favors. Its appeal lies in being a civilian automobile built as American manufacturing shifted toward military production.
Late blackout cars attract particular attention, but only when the finish treatment is supported by credible evidence. An untouched Custom with original tags, drivetrain, trim, interior remnants, and wartime documentation can be more instructive than a highly polished restoration with incorrect chrome and postwar fittings.
Body style also influences demand and restoration difficulty. Open cars and wood-bodied wagons are visually dramatic but require expensive specialist work, while sedans often preserve more original fabric and hardware. Across all forms, completeness matters because model-specific grille, lighting, dashboard, and decorative pieces are not as easily replaced as engine or brake service parts.
Cultural Relevance
The D22 belongs to the small group of 1942 American civilian cars that visibly record wartime material conservation. Its simplified late-production trim has become part of home-front automotive history, linking private transportation with the federal controls that redirected Detroit's factories.
Club activity centers on preservation, Chrysler flathead engineering, Fluid Drive service, and the documentation of surviving blackout vehicles. The model has little meaningful racing legacy, and its cultural value does not depend on one. It represents the ordinary sedan, coupe, or family car whose replacement became difficult once civilian assembly stopped and new automobiles largely disappeared from dealer inventories.
Frequently Asked Questions
What engine does the 1942 Dodge D22 Custom use?
It uses a 230.2-cubic-inch L-head inline-six with a 3.25-inch bore, 4.625-inch stroke, and factory rating of 105 horsepower at 3,600 rpm. The engine is naturally aspirated and fed by a single downdraft carburetor.
Is the D22 the correct model code for every 1942 Dodge passenger car?
D22 is the principal Dodge passenger-car model designation for the 1942 model year. Identity should still be confirmed through the serial plate, engine stamping, body information, and factory documentation because titles and replacement components can create conflicting evidence.
What is a 1942 Dodge blackout car?
Blackout is the collector term for a late civilian-production car built with reduced brightwork or painted trim as strategic materials were restricted. It was a production treatment rather than a separate performance model, and authenticity requires more evidence than black-painted exterior parts.
Did the D22 Custom have an automatic transmission?
No. Fluid Drive was a fluid coupling used with a clutch and conventional three-speed manual transmission. It allowed smoother engagement and permitted the car to remain stationary in gear, but the driver still selected gears manually.
How can an original D22 engine be identified?
Inspect the stamped engine number and its model prefix, then compare casting dates and component tags with the vehicle's serial and production evidence. A correct-type block is not automatically the factory-installed engine, and Dodge did not use modern VIN matching across all components.
What are the most serious restoration problems?
Structural rust, missing D22-specific trim, cooling-system corrosion, incorrect blackout restoration, damaged Fluid Drive components, and undocumented engine substitutions can dominate a project. Mechanical service parts are generally easier to obtain than correct grille, interior, lighting, and decorative pieces.
Why is the D22 Custom collectible?
Its short 1942 civilian production, distinctive one-year styling, flathead-six drivetrain, and direct connection to wartime manufacturing controls give it specific historical value. Documented blackout examples and substantially original cars carry the strongest research and preservation interest.
